Subject: On-call heads-up — Driftnet sweeper

Welcome to the rotation. The Driftnet orphaned-resource sweeper runs hourly and deletes volumes and load balancers with no owning project. It pages when deletions exceed the safety cap of 40 per run. Do not raise the cap without approval from the Harrow team. Support tickets about "missing resources" usually trace back to Driftnet; check its deletion log first. Escalation steps and the pause procedure are on the page below.

wiki page, tahaf-tajog: https://jira.ordindyn.corp/pipeline

Fan-out backpressure for the Quillet notifier: when the queue depth crosses the soft limit, the dispatcher sheds low-priority pushes and batches the rest at 500ms intervals. Reviewer should confirm the shed counter is exported and that retries respect the jitter window. Once merged, the release artifact gets re-signed by the pipeline, which expects the deploy key shown below.

deploy key for bawep-yawif: bky6_GQhaSt

Build Provenance: Gridsmith Crossword Generator. Every published puzzle pack must trace back to a reproducible build. The packer embeds the dictionary snapshot hash, the theme-constraint config, and the solver version into the pack manifest. QA pulls these fields to verify that a reported clue bug matches the generator state that produced it. For the eng sync: packs missing provenance fields are now rejected at upload. Each accepted pack carries the build token shown below.

pipeline stamp: htk21_104c5ba7d0df6b2897cd5

Subject: Scheduled key rotation for Pixelwash EXIF service

Hi Marta,

As part of the quarterly rotation, we're retiring the current credentials for Pixelwash, the internal service that scrubs EXIF metadata from uploaded images before they reach the CDN. The old key stops working Friday at 18:00, so please update the release pipeline config before cutting the 4.2 build. Verify the scrub step passes in staging after swapping. The new key for the Pixelwash endpoint is below.

service key, fawip-bajef: kto11_Qt5wZK9vdNC